Summary
After yet another silent standoff with my childhood sweetheart, I didn’t go and coax him this time.
All my friends came to talk me around.
“He’s just awkward. He says the opposite of what he means. “Someone that emotionally tangled needs a patient lover.”
But I was truly tired.
I didn’t want to be the one to back down anymore.
All these years of cold wars, arguments, and avoidance…
They had worn me down so much that I could no longer tell whether he really was just emotionally tangled, or whether he no longer loved me.
So when he threatened me with a breakup again, I said, “Then let’s break up.”
